Modern Slavery Act Transparency

Royal Case Company is committed to combating modern slavery and human trafficking in our business
operations and supply chains. This statement outlines the steps we have taken during the financial year
to ensure that slavery and human trafficking are not taking place in any part of our business or supply
chains.

Our Business and Supply Chains
Royal Case Company manufactures and distributes high-quality cases and packaging solutions. We work
with a network of suppliers both domestically and internationally to source materials and components
for our products.

Policies and Procedures
We have implemented several policies and procedures to address the risks of modern slavery:
• A Supplier Code of Conduct that explicitly prohibits the use of forced labor, child labor, and
human trafficking
• Regular risk assessments of our supply chain to identify areas of potential concern
• Due diligence processes when onboarding new suppliers, including questionnaires about their
labor practices
• Contractual clauses requiring suppliers to comply with all applicable labor laws and regulations

Training and Awareness
All employees involved in procurement and supply chain management receive training on identifying and
reporting potential signs of modern slavery. We also conduct awareness campaigns to educate our wider
workforce about this important issue.

Risk Assessment and Due Diligence
We have conducted a risk assessment of our supply chain and identified certain raw material suppliers in
high-risk countries as areas requiring additional scrutiny. For these suppliers, we conduct enhanced due
diligence, including on-site audits where feasible.
